What Greek word meaning "to act" is the origin for the Drama?

Answer:

The term "drama" comes from a Greek word " draō " meaning " to do / to act " (Classical Greek: δρᾶμα, drama), which is derived from "I do" (Classical Greek: δράω, drao). The two masks associated with drama represent the traditional generic division between comedy and tragedy.
